Lighting

Как спроектированы испытательные пространства разработки

Как спроектированы испытательные пространства разработки

Проверочная окружение создания составляет собой изолированное среду для испытания программного ПО. Программисты выстраивают обособленную инфраструктуру, которая моделирует действительные обстоятельства функционирования системы. Такая структура объединяет серверы, базы данных, сетевые компоненты и иные технические компоненты.

Группы проектирования используют Вулкан казино для защищенного испытания новых опций. Обособленное пространство позволяет тестировать код без опасности испортить действующий систему. Профессионалы запускают продукт в управляемых параметрах и оценивают его работу.

Архитектура испытательного пространства копирует архитектуру производственной системы. Специалисты выстраивают настройки, развертывают зависимости и создают сведения для валидации. Каждый элемент приложения должен функционировать так же как продуктовой версии.

Процесс формирования проверочного окружения предполагает существенных возможностей. Фирмы распределяют компьютерные ресурсы, базы сведений и сетевую инфраструктуру. Корректно настроенная инфраструктура позволяет выявлять ошибки на первых периодах разработки. Профессиональное тестирование минимизирует объем неточностей в конечном релизе решения.

Зачем нужны отдельные окружения для тестирования

Самостоятельные пространства для тестирования охраняют боевые среды от непредсказуемых результатов. Свежий код вероятно включать серьезные неточности, которые спровоцируют к неполадкам в работе приложения. Изолированное окружение дает возможность определить неполадки до их попадания к конечным пользователям.

Специалисты тестируют с различными вариантами воплощения функций. Тестовое пространство открывает возможность пробовать необычные решения без опасений нарушить организации. Группы могут откатывать изменения и стартовать валидацию повторно в произвольный период.

Одновременная активность нескольких специалистов предполагает автономных окружений. Каждый программист проверяет свои изменения, не создавая помехи товарищам. Разделение устраняет конфликты между различными версиями казино Вулкан и стимулирует процесс проектирования.

Сохранность данных заказчиков продолжает быть приоритетом при проверке. Подлинная сведения потребителей не обязана применяться в тестах. Самостоятельная среда оперирует с искусственными информацией, которые воспроизводят действительные записи. Такой прием устраняет утечки приватной данных и исполняет предписания регулирования о сохранности личных данных.

Чем проверочная система отличается от производственной

Проверочная платформа эксплуатирует сокращенную архитектуру по контрасту с рабочей системой. Организации оптимизируют возможности, выделяя меньше серверных средств для проверки приложения. Продуктовое среда выполняет вызовы тысяч потребителей параллельно, тогда как испытательное окружение рассчитано на минимальную интенсивность.

Данные в проверочной системе являются собой синтетически созданные информацию. Программисты создают данные, которая дублирует архитектуру реальных сведений пользователей. Производственная система имеет действующие информацию потребителей и запрашивает строгих шагов безопасности.

Отслеживание и логирование действуют по-разному в двух типах окружений. Тестовое пространство регистрирует подробную сведения о каждой процессе для исследования Игровые автоматы и определения дефектов. Рабочая инфраструктура сохраняет лишь серьезные события, чтобы не загружать накопители информации.

Допуск к тестовой инфраструктуре имеют разработчики и сотрудники по качеству. Производственное среда доступно для реальных пользователей и запрашивает тщательного контроля обновлений. Каждое изменение продуктовой инфраструктуры проходит через поэтапное одобрение, тогда как испытательная среда обеспечивает моментально применять правки для опытов.

Как формируются реплики программ для тестирования

Процесс разворачивания дубликата системы инициируется с дублирования оригинального кода из репозитория. Разработчики скачивают свежую релиз программы и устанавливают модули на тестовых узлах. Платформа контроля итераций помогает выбрать требуемую редакцию для размещения.

Параметрические данные модифицируются под требования проверочного пространства. Специалисты указывают расположения баз данных, опции сетевых соединений и технологические настройки. Корректная настройка создает правильную выполнение продукта в отдельном среде.

База информации копируется с задействованием утилит миграции. Команды формируют дамп продуктовой платформы и мигрируют организацию таблиц в проверочное хранилище. Конфиденциальные информация меняются обезличенными параметрами для следования правил охраны.

Автоматизированное развертывание установки повышает скорость формирование вулкан казино зеркало и снижает риск ошибок. Сценарии исполняют действия для инсталляции зависимостей и старта служб. Контейнеризация обеспечивает инкапсулировать продукт в автономный блок. Данный прием обеспечивает одинаковость окружений на различных периодах создания.

Какие категории проверочных сред присутствуют

Платформа проектирования создана для разработки и тестирования софта разработчиками. Каждый эксперт действует на индивидуальном машине или отдельном хосте. Разработчики оперативно применяют модификации и проверяют основную возможности элементов.

Интеграционная система объединяет программу от нескольких сотрудников команды. Инструмент программно строит систему и инициирует проверки взаимодействия компонентов. Такой категория среды находит конфликты между элементами Вулкан казино на ранней периоде.

Инфраструктура испытания эксплуатируется специалистами по проверке для тщательной тестирования возможностей. Тестировщики реализуют сценарии работы и фиксируют определенные дефекты. Среда хранит стабильную итерацию продукта для систематического исследования.

Предпродакшн среда наиболее схожа к продуктовой инфраструктуре. Группы осуществляют заключительную тестирование перед релизом апдейтов. Данное среда способствует обнаружить дефекты быстродействия и интеграции с фактической структурой.

Демонстрационная платформа организуется для выступлений заказчикам. Окружение имеет созданные данные и готовые кейсы презентации возможностей системы.

Как валидируются новые возможности

Тестирование свежих возможностей стартует с оценки требований к проектируемому элементу. Специалисты изучают документацию и формируют перечень испытаний для валидации функционирования приложения. Каждая функция обязана отвечать объявленным свойствам.

Модульное проверка тестирует обособленные части кода в изолированности. Инженеры разрабатывают автоматизированные испытания, которые запускают процедуры и проверяют результаты с планируемыми результатами. Подобный прием дает возможность незамедлительно находить дефекты в алгоритме софта.

Интеграционное проверка оценивает интеграцию свежей опции с текущими компонентами. Команды валидируют передачу информации между блоками и точность процессинга запросов. Специалисты используют механизмы для симуляции разнообразных вариантов казино Вулкан функционирования.

Функциональное проверка выполняется с угла взгляда реального клиента. Специалисты воспроизводят обычные варианты эксплуатации и тестируют соответствие итогов предположениям. Коллектив регистрирует обнаруженные ошибки для исправления.

Регрессионное проверка подтверждает, что новый софт не испортил выполнение имеющейся опций.

Почему существенно локализовать баги

Обособление ошибок блокирует расползание ошибок на продуктовую систему. Критическая ошибка в продуктовой инфраструктуре может привести к уничтожению данных потребителей и блокировке процессов. Проверочное пространство дает возможность выявить дефект до ее доступа к пользователям.

Локализация дефектов повышает скорость процесс корректировки устранения. Разработчики точно выявляют элемент с дефектом и концентрируются на корректировке точного блока программы. Изолированная валидация предотвращает эффект иных элементов Игровые автоматы на итоги исследования.

Тестовая платформа обеспечивает надежное окружение для опытов с корректировками. Группы пробуют множественные варианты корректировки без опасности ухудшить положение.

Изоляция багов предоставляет следующие преимущества:

  • Сохранение престижа организации от неблагоприятных комментариев;
  • Снижение экономических расходов от остановки платформы;
  • Поддержание доверия заказчиков к приложению;
  • Уменьшение периода на определение корня неполадки.

Документирование изолированных багов способствует избежать возвращение неполадок в будущем. Команды исследуют причины багов и оптимизируют методы построения.

Как команды взаимодействуют с тестовыми окружениями

Коллективы построения эксплуатируют механизм управления входом для оперирования с тестовыми пространствами. Каждый специалист получает учетные сведения с установленными полномочиями в корреляции от роли. Разработчики устанавливают код, тестировщики запускают проверки, техники управляют структурой.

Процесс запуска изменений соответствует утвержденному регламенту. Программисты сохраняют программу в репозитории и генерируют запрос на слияние. Программная система формирует систему и размещает свежую редакцию в испытательном среде.

Координация между сотрудниками выполняется через платформу контроля работ. Эксперты фиксируют выявленные неполадки, устанавливают исполнителей и мониторят прогресс операций. Прозрачность процессов дает возможность продуктивно назначать казино Вулкан средства и проверять сроки.

Систематические собрания группы анализируют результаты тестирования и намечают дальнейшие меры. Члены делятся данными о проблемах и выдвигают решения. Коллективная деятельность ускоряет корректировку ошибок.

Фиксация практик помогает новым членам команды незамедлительно постичь работу с проверочными платформами.

Важность испытательных платформ в надежности системы

Тестовые окружения формируют основу для поддержания стабильности программного решения. Систематическая валидация обновлений в отдельном пространстве сокращает число ошибок в продуктовой инфраструктуре. Группы обнаруживают существенные ошибки до запуска и блокируют вредное влияние на потребителей.

Непрерывное тестирование гарантирует превосходное качество кодовой базы. Автоматические тесты инициируются по завершении каждого апдейта и оповещают о неполадках интеграции. Программисты приобретают возвратную отклик о эффекте обновлений на выполнение Игровые автоматы среды.

Прогнозируемость функционирования продукта достигается через многоступенчатое валидацию. Каждая опция получает тестирование на различных периодах в специализированных окружениях. Всесторонний прием удостоверяет совпадение решения критериям качества.

Уменьшение рисков при запуске изменений Вулкан казино связана от уровня испытания. Команды задействуют препродуктовую инфраструктуру для итоговой тестирования перед установкой. Подобная практика защищает бизнес от экономических убытков.

Перспективная стабильность решения нуждается непрерывного совершенствования процессов проверки и роста архитектуры.

Older

Pokerdom – Официальный сайт онлайн казино Покердом

Newer

Как функционируют рекламные механизмы в сети

Leave a Reply

Your email address will not be published. Required fields are marked *

Shopping cart
Sign in

No account yet?

Create an Account
Product Categories
Follow: